Geopolitical tensions hinder Bitcoin’s $100K prospects by June 2026: Binance Research

Binance Research reports that geopolitical tensions, especially the US-Israel-Iran conflict, are dampening Bitcoin's chances of reaching $100K by June 2026.

Could geopolitical tensions really be the brakes on Bitcoin’s journey to $100,000 this June? According to a recent report from Binance Research, that appears to be the case. The findings reveal that ongoing tensions, particularly the US-Israel-Iran conflict, are dampening the optimism surrounding Bitcoin as it approaches the mid-year mark.

What Does Binance Research Say About Bitcoin’s $100K Prospects?

In their latest findings, Binance Research highlights that the odds of Bitcoin hitting the coveted $100,000 mark by June 30, 2026, remain low. What’s Behind These Geopolitical Tensions?

The report emphasizes the impact of macroeconomic concerns, particularly the escalating tensions involving the US, Israel, and Iran. These geopolitical dynamics are not solely affecting Bitcoin; they are shaping the overall market landscape. Investors are currently seeking safe havens, leading to a noticeable increase in the use of stablecoins. This shift demonstrates a growing wariness amongst traders regarding broader market instability.

What About Institutional Interest?

Despite the bearish outlook presented by Binance Research, there is a glimmer of resilience in certain market segments. Institutional interest in tokenized real-world assets has surged, reaching $27.6 billion. This figure indicates a certain level of market stability even as Bitcoin struggles to gain traction toward its price target. However, this institutional activity doesn’t directly translate into the short-term optimism needed for Bitcoin's potential climb to six figures.
